Training activity information

Details

Explore a change to practice standards against and/or recognised guidelines for a specific procedure/patient group and reflect on the impact this will have on practice

Type

Observational training activity (OTA)

Evidence requirements

Evidence the observation or experience has been undertaken by the trainee.

Reflections on the observation or experience at two timepoints including contextualisation to the trainees own practice. E.g., for planned observations, a reflection before the observation and after, or for unplanned events a reflection one day after and another reflection a week later.

Considerations

  • Reflect on the impact this will have on practice, considering:
    • Recommended practice change
    • Local, national and international guidelines
    • Disease conditions/presentations
    • Impact on patient care
